Fluvanna, Jamestown Neighborhood

Nestled along the banks of Chautauqua Lake, Fluvanna is a welcoming neighborhood in Jamestown, NY, known for its charming mix of mid-century cottages and ranch-style homes shaded by mature trees. Residents enjoy a close-knit, friendly community atmosphere and easy access to lakeside parks, local shops, and scenic walking trails, making Fluvanna a hidden gem for those seeking relaxed, lakeside living.

Jamestown offers a peaceful setting characterized by quiet streets and a calm atmosphere. The community provides convenient access to various grocery stores, restaurants, and cafes, making daily necessities easily attainable. Educational options abound, with both public and private primary and secondary schools located close to most residences. The housing stock primarily features charming two- and three-bedroom single detached homes and duplexes, many reflecting classic pre-1960 architecture. Parking is generally convenient, and several bus lines with nearby stops offer additional transit options. Though bicycling infrastructure is limited due to the area’s topography, the overall accessibility and amenities contribute to a comfortable living environment.

The character of Jamestown is exemplified by its slower-paced ambience. Most areas in Jamestown are very quiet, as the streets are usually very tranquil.

🌳 Fluvanna Community Park

Nestled along Fluvanna Avenue, this spacious neighborhood park offers residents and visitors a beautiful green space with playgrounds, picnic areas, and plenty of room for outdoor activities, serving as a local hub for community gatherings and recreation.

🏫 Fluvanna Free Library

Located on Fluvanna Avenue, the Fluvanna Free Library is a beloved neighborhood institution, providing residents with access to books, educational programs, and community events, fostering a sense of learning and connection in an intimate, friendly setting.

🍽️ Phil-N-Cindy’s Lunch

This classic diner on Fluvanna Avenue offers homemade comfort food and a welcoming atmosphere, making it a popular breakfast and lunch stop for locals who appreciate hearty meals and friendly service with a touch of small-town charm.

🛒 Fluvanna Avenue Shopping Strip

Running along Fluvanna Avenue, this convenient cluster of shops—ranging from grocery stores to local services—caters directly to neighborhood needs, providing residents with easy access to daily essentials and supporting small local businesses.

🚴 Chautauqua Lake Bike Path

This scenic section of the bike path runs close to Fluvanna, giving residents and visitors a safe and picturesque route for walking, biking, or jogging with beautiful lake views and direct access to lakeside breezes.
